The updater daemon verifies the manifest signature before staging, rejects any rollback below the pinned epoch, and refuses unsigned deltas outright. Staging occurs on the inactive partition; activation requires a verified boot measurement. Review the attestation path carefully: the channel endpoint is mutually authenticated, and key rotation is automated on a 90-day cycle. No operator override exists for signature failures. The production channel service runs with the configuration values listed below.

deployment values, yadug-bawif:
[framir]
team = pelox
access_code = ac_a38ab2
owner = tamion.julael
host = framir.tolvaqlabs.test
port = 11211
peer = tammir.zemvargrid.local
salt = 2215ef03
pin = 1541

[ ] Verify the Merrowbank user-profile store shard migration: confirm all sixteen shards report healthy in the Ostrel dashboard, replay a sample of 500 profile reads against both old and new topology, and check that the rebalancer has drained the legacy partition. If any shard lags, page storage on-call and cite the build token below.

pipeline stamp: htk31_f769b577b3028a4e9958e5bb8d1259a

Ticket: Missed pick-up — payslips for Grindel Point site

The Tuesday courier run skipped the payslip envelope for Grindel Point, which has no printer on site, so staff there have nothing for this period. Payroll at Ashdown House has re-sealed the envelope and it is waiting at reception. Please schedule a replacement run for tomorrow morning and brief the courier accordingly. The hand-over at Grindel Point must follow this instruction.

handover note for yagef-bagep: the drudor pelius courier leaves the kasdor zorvan norir ledger at gate 8016 under passcode 755406